A statement from Ontario PC Leader Tim Hudak on Annual Tamil Memorial Week:

“Today marks the 5th anniversary of the end of decades-long civil war in Sri Lanka that cost tens of thousands of lives and dramatically impacted the lives of Ontario’s Tamil-Canadian community.

“This annual memorial week is vital to ensuring we never forget the innocent civilians killed during that war. It also gives us the opportunity to once again demand justice for those who died, for the families still living in that country, and for those who fled abroad.

“As Leader of the Ontario PC Party, I again stand with Prime Minister Stephen Harper in calling for accountability from the Sri Lankan government.

“It was a proud moment for our party earlier this year when, thanks to the hard work of my caucus colleague, Todd Smith (Prince Edward-Hastings) the Ontario Legislature passed an Ontario PC bill to forever mark January as Tamil Heritage Month.
